Parallel computations and construction law of model description for digital signal processing algorithms
O. V. Klimova Institute of Engineering Science, Urals Branch, Russian Academy of Sciences, Ekaterinburg
Abstract:
The formal solution of development problem of digital signal processing parallel algorithms is offered. The main content of solution presented is development of construction law of model description for algorithms. The study results of intrinsic algorithm structure are the basis of the solution. These results create the theoretical basis for mathematical modelling of algorithms. The development of the composition forms for description of intrinsic structure of operations defines the results. On the basis of the results the general construction law of model description of algorithms is formulated. The possibilities of the description are noted. The realization on formal basis of the concurrent optimization of both algorithms and architectures is one of the main possibilities. That coexploration of algorithms and architectures is integral part of design process of modern computation systems as its use at the design allows to raise efficiency of parallel processing.
